site stats

Git resync

WebMay 30, 2024 · 6. In addition to the above answers, there is always the scorched earth method. rm -R . in Windows shell the command is: rd /s . Then you can just checkout the project again: git clone -v . This will definitely remove any local changes and pull the latest from the remote repository. WebSep 4, 2024 · 0. Check if git config pull.rebase is set to true, as I mentioned here. That would means any git pull would actually replay your un-pushed local commits on top of the updated remote origin/master tracking branch. If the local history seems correct, a simple git push should resolve the issue. Share.

GitHub - resync/resync: A Python library and client …

WebSyncing a fork branch from the web UI. On GitHub, navigate to the main page of the forked repository that you want to sync with the upstream repository. Select the Sync fork dropdown. Review the details about the commits from the upstream repository, then click Update branch . If the changes from the upstream repository cause conflicts, GitHub ... WebOct 12, 2015 · Bring the local repository to in sync with remote. git stash git pull origin git stash pop`. Apply my stash changes. If you want to keep your stash on the stash list: git stash apply if you want to remove the stash from the stash list: git stash pop. And your all set. Hope this helps. mongols impact on western civilization https://sticki-stickers.com

Reset and sync local repository with remote branch OCPsoft

WebIn the middle of our feature, we realize there’s a security hole in our project. # Create a hotfix branch based off of master git checkout -b hotfix master # Edit files git commit -a -m "Fix security hole" # Merge back into master … WebJul 1, 2024 · 3 Answers. The solution mentioned in ".gitignore file not ignoring" is a bit extreme, but should work: # rm all files git rm -r --cached . # add all files as per new .gitignore git add . # now, commit for new .gitignore to apply git commit -m ".gitignore is now working". ( make sure to commit first your changes you want to keep, to avoid any ... WebMar 1, 2013 · Now that you're here, you can try (from master ): git merge tmp-master. But for cleaner commit history you may want to try the following: git checkout tmp-master git rebase master git checkout master git merge --ff tmp-master git branch -d tmp-master git push origin master. This will take your local commits and reapply them on top of the … mongols impact on china

How to sync local git repo with origin/master eliminating all changes

Category:merge - Git sync changes with remote master - Stack Overflow

Tags:Git resync

Git resync

git synchronization of rebased branches - Stack Overflow

Webresync. resync is a ResourceSync library with supporting client scipts, written in python.ResourceSync is a synchronization framework for the web consisting of various … WebFirst step was to expand the Visual Studio Code window large enough so I could see details! In the lower left-hand corner there is a "head-and-sholders" icon (Accounts) that had an alert dot asking me to login/authorize VSCode to access GitHub.

Git resync

Did you know?

WebApr 20, 2024 · 3. I'm newbie to git. I have a repository on bitbucket. Now I want to download it on my computer at work and make some changes on the project, then push it again. First of all I initialized the git on a local directory by this line: $ git init. Then I set something configuration: $ git config --global user.name "my name" $ git config --global ... WebDec 6, 2013 · As yet another alternative way to get the repository history, you could initialize the downloaded zip as a new Git repository, add the remote repository, fetch, and reset to it: unzip project.zip cd project git init git remote add origin url_on_github git fetch origin git reset origin/master git status. The git fetch step will get the history.

WebMay 25, 2010 · If you don't mind overriding changes in your network share, you can do this: git fetch origin master git reset --hard origin/master. This will reset the local master to the origin master. Warning: this is a hard reset, it will lose all your changes (committed* or not). But I'm assuming you don't really have any changes there, and it's mostly ... WebMar 8, 2024 · You can back it up like so: git commit -a -m "Branch backup" git branch branch-backup. Now run the command below to reset your remote branch to origin. If you have a different remote and default branch name (not origin or main, respectively), just replace them with the appropriate name. git fetch origin git reset --hard origin/main.

WebDec 2, 2024 · Until git add --renormalize the only way to do that was to force Git to copy from index to work-tree: rm worktreefile git checkout -- worktreefile. or force Git to copy from work-tree to index: git add worktreefile. both of which fix up the index's cache data, but obviously do a bit of additional violence in the process. WebNov 20, 2014 · 4. Delete the branch, then pull both branches from the remote repository. git branch -D BUG_37 git pull origin master git pull origin BUG_37:BUG_37. If you don't want to delete your local BUG_37 branch before being sure that this works, pull the remote branch into another local branch: git pull origin BUG_37:NEW_BUG_37.

WebNow see how the file looks like if you check it out from the tree. First, check out the version before you created the file (go 1 commit back). The file text.txt vanishes from the working directory: git checkout ~1. Now, restore the version …

mongols in americaWebFeb 16, 2024 · Reset and sync local repository with remote branch. The command: Remember to replace origin and master with the remote and branch that you want to synchronize with. git fetch origin git reset --hard origin/master git clean -f -d. Your local … mongols in european artWebApr 27, 2024 · 2 Answers. Sorted by: 3. As far as I know there is no solution for this without modify the repo tool, but you always can create an alias (in GNU/Linux) in the file ~/.bash_aliases or ~/.bashrc: alias repo-lfs = "repo sync && repo forall -c git lfs pull"". Then source the file source ~/bash_aliases and instead using repo sync use repo-lfs command. mongols invading chinaWebSep 21, 2024 · Visual Studio helps you keep your local branch synchronized with your remote branch through download (fetch and pull) and upload (push) operations. You can … mongols international lawWebSyncing a fork branch from the web UI. On GitHub, navigate to the main page of the forked repository that you want to sync with the upstream repository. Select the Sync fork … mongols in asiaWebSep 14, 2012 · Warning: git novice here. I have downloaded the source code of an open-source project (ffmpeg, to be exact) using git (git clone). I checked out an older revision in order to do test it (git checkout [version number]), and git told me that I'm now in a detached HEAD state. Now I want to resync again to the latest remote revision, but I don't ... mongols in china yearsWebSep 22, 2012 · The command: Remember to replace origin and master with the remote and branch that you want to synchronize with. git fetch origin && git reset --hard … mongols influence on russia